Ribbed metal siding repair services focus on restoring the integrity and appearance of metal siding that features a distinctive ribbed or corrugated pattern. Over time, exposure to weather elements such as rain, snow, and wind can cause the metal to develop issues like rust, corrosion, dents, or warping. Repair professionals assess the extent of damage, remove compromised sections if necessary, and replace or patch areas to prevent further deterioration. This process helps ensure the siding continues to serve as a protective barrier for the property while maintaining its original aesthetic.
Many problems can be addressed through ribbed metal siding repair, including rust spots that compromise the material’s strength, loose or missing panels that leave parts of the building vulnerable, and physical damage from impacts or severe weather. Additionally, aging siding may lose its sealant, leading to leaks or drafts that affect indoor comfort and energy efficiency. Repair services can also resolve issues caused by improper installation or previous damage, helping to extend the lifespan of the siding and preserving the property's value.

The overview below groups typical Ribbed Metal Siding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Farmington,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or ribbed metal siding repairs in Farmington, CT often range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or sealing jobs fall within this middle tier, depending on the extent of damage and material costs.
Moderate Fixes - More involved repairs, such as replacing several panels or addressing underlying issues,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ners seeking to restore siding with moderate scope.
Large Repairs - Extensive repairs, including significant panel replacements or structural fixes, can range from $1,500 to $3,500. Fewer projects reach this level, but larger, more complex jobs can sometimes exceed this range.
Full Replacement - Complete siding replacement typically costs $4,000 to $8,000 or more, depending on the size of the building and material choices. Many service providers handle projects at the lower to mid-range, with larger homes pushing into the higher end of the sp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of damage can be repaired on ribbed metal siding? Local contractors can address issues like dents, corrosion, loose panels, and minor cracks to restore the integrity and appearance of ribbed metal siding.
How do professionals typically repair ribbed metal siding? Repair methods often include panel replacement, patching damaged areas, and applying protective coatings to prevent future corrosion.
Is it possible to match existing ribbed metal siding during repairs? Skilled service providers can often find or custom-fabricate panels that closely match the existing siding for a seamless repair.
What signs indicate that ribbed metal siding needs repair? Common signs include visible dents, rust spots, loose panels, water leaks, or damage from severe weather conditions.
